Taking Action When Workplace Rights May Have Been Violated

If employment concerns develop, taking a thoughtful approach may help protect important interests. Workplace disagreements may include extensive documentation, making careful preparation highly beneficial.

Individuals working with a Long Beach Employment Lawyer are often encouraged to gather available evidence before evaluating their legal options. Useful documentation may include written employment documents, payroll information, workplace messages, and related records.

"Well-organized documentation often provides a clearer picture of workplace events and may assist in evaluating employment disputes."

Although no two more info cases are identical, careful planning may support informed decision-making.

  • Maintain copies of important employment documents whenever legally appropriate.
  • Document conversations and workplace developments when appropriate.
  • Become familiar with company guidelines that may relate to the issue.
  • Consult qualified legal counsel regarding available options.
